Change Your Story Change Your World

"Ivan Illich, the educator and philosopher, was once asked what he thought was the most radical way to change society. Was it through violent revolution or gradual reform? He gave a careful answer: neither. Rather he suggested that if one wanted to change society, one must tell an alternative story." (Alan Hirsch & David Ferguson. "On The Verge")
